Top Software and Frameworks for iOS Development
The iOS field is constantly evolving. A successful iOS developer must stay ahead with the latest industry-standard tools to stay competitive. These solutions and software include:
- Swift & Objective-C: These are core programming languages for iOS development.
- Xcode: This is the primary development tool for building, testing, and debugging iOS apps.
- SwiftUI & UIKit: Developers rely on these frameworks to craft engaging user experiences for iOS devices.
- Core Data: This is a framework for efficient data management in mobile apps.
- ARKit & Core ML: iOS developers leverage these solutions to integrate AI and augmented reality in app development.
Understanding these frameworks and solutions makes securing a job easier after graduation. Employers want to see that developers are proficient in these tools, which are critical to iOS development.

Demand for iOS Developers in 2025 and Beyond
With over 1.5 billion active Apple devices worldwide, the need for innovative iOS applications continues to grow. This expansion is driven by the popularity of iOS devices and high user engagement, making iOS development a promising career path.
Moreover, mobile app developers' revenue is expected to reach £28.3 billion in 2025, with a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 12.9%. This growth translates into continuous demand for skilled developers to create, maintain, and innovate apps on the iOS platform across various sectors.
Average Salaries and Growth Opportunities
Aspiring iOS developers can expect competitive salaries that reflect their specialised skills. The average salary for an iOS developer in the UK is £54,120 annually. Developers can find the most lucrative jobs in Bristol, followed by Leeds, London, and Sheffield. In cities such as Machester, Glasglow, Cambridge, Nottingham, and Edinburgh, professionals can earn between £40,000 and £50,000 yearly.
While these are average figures for an iOS developer's earning potential, learning new technologies and refining your skillset can secure more lucrative jobs. Students must stay updated with job postings, iOS technology updates, and market trends to ensure they find the perfect position.

Acing the iOS Developer Interview Process
Technical interviews for iOS developer roles typically involve multiple stages, testing your theoretical and practical skills. Here's an overview of the different stages of standard iOS developer interviews:
- Applicant Screening: A recruiter evaluates your background and interest in the role.
- Technical Interviews: Expect coding challenges where you must write code to solve algorithmic problems or build small iOS applications. Familiarise yourself with data structures like arrays, linked lists, and hash tables.
- Live Coding & System Design: You may be asked to develop a minor feature using Swift or React Native while explaining your approach.
- Behavioural Interview: Companies assess how well you communicate and fit within their team.

Choosing between freelancing and full-time employment as an iOS developer in the UK involves evaluating various factors, including income stability, flexibility, and career development opportunities.
Freelancing
Freelancing as an iOS developer offers excellent flexibility. Professionals can often determine their working hours and conditions. In the UK, freelance iOS developers typically charge between £60 and £120 per hour, varying rates based on experience and project complexity.
However, there are a few drawbacks to consider. These are the benefits and advantages of freelancing as an iOS developer.
Pros:
- Flexibility: Freelancers can schedule and select projects that align with their interests and expertise.
- Diverse Experience: Working with multiple clients across industries can enhance your skill set and portfolio.
- Income Potential: Freelance websites allow you to find job opportunities worldwide, allowing you to find the most lucrative position.
Cons:
- Income Variability: Freelancers may experience fluctuations in income due to the inconsistent nature of project-based work.
- Self-Employment Responsibilities: Managing taxes, healthcare, and retirement planning falls solely on the freelancer.
- Communication: Interacting with companies internationally can be tricky in terms of communication, as freelancers often operate in various time zones.
Full-Time Employment
Unlike freelance work, full-time employment is much more structured and offers long-term reliability. Here is a glance at the advantages and disadvantages of working as a full-time iOS developer.
Pros:
- Job Security: Full-time positions offer a steady income and benefits such as healthcare, retirement plans, and paid leave.
- Structured Career Progression: Employees often have access to professional development resources and clear advancement pathways within a company.
- Reliable Income: iOS developers in full-time employment can expect the same salary paid every month, making it easier to make financial decisions.
Cons:
- Less Autonomy: Full-time roles may come with rigid schedules and less control over project selection.
- Potential for Monotony: Working on long-term projects for a single employer might limit exposure to diverse challenges.
- Micro Managing: Full-time employees are often heavily micro-managed, which may not be ideal for some iOS developers.
Making the Decision
When choosing between freelance or full-time iOS developer jobs, consider your personal preferences, financial goals, and desired work-life balance. Some professionals opt for a hybrid approach, maintaining a full-time job while taking on freelance projects to diversify their experience and income streams.

The iOS development landscape in the UK is dynamic, with several emerging trends shaping the industry's future. These are a few top future trends in the iOS job market.
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Machine Learning (ML) Integration
Integrating AI and ML into iOS applications enhances user experiences through personalised content and predictive analytics. Developers leverage frameworks like Core ML to implement features like image recognition and natural language processing.
Augmented Reality (AR) and Virtual Reality (VR) Applications
AR and VR technologies are gaining traction, particularly in retail, education, and gaming. With tools like ARKit, iOS developers can create immersive experiences that blend digital content with the physical world.
Internet of Things (IoT) Integration
The rise of IoT devices presents opportunities for iOS developers to create applications that interact seamlessly with smart home technologies and wearables, enhancing user convenience and connectivity.
Emphasis on App Security and Privacy
With increasing concerns over data privacy, there is a heightened focus on implementing robust security measures within iOS applications. Developers are prioritising user data protection to comply with regulations and build trust.
Adoption of Swift 6 and SwiftUI
The release of Swift 6 and advancements in SwiftUI are streamlining the development process, enabling developers to build more efficient and user-friendly applications. These tools offer improved performance and enhanced capabilities for creating dynamic user interfaces.
